Research Interests

Ms. Candlish studies the effect of clouds on the energy balance of the Arctic. Measuring parameters such as fractional coverage, vertical distribution, and composition, is key to predicting how clouds will influence, and be influenced by, a changing climate. Currently, Ms. Candlish is conducting a study that tests the reliability of satellite cloud detection compared to ground-based techniques.
